""The Fact of Christ: A Series of Lectures"" by P. Carnegie Simpson is a collection of lectures that explore the historical evidence for the existence and divinity of Jesus Christ. The book delves into the life and teachings of Jesus from a historical perspective, examining the reliability of the New Testament accounts and the testimony of early Christian writers. Simpson also addresses common objections to the Christian faith and offers compelling arguments for the truth of the Gospel message. The lectures are well-researched and accessible to both scholars and lay readers alike. Overall, ""The Fact of Christ"" is a thought-provoking and informative exploration of the evidence for Christianity.This scarce antiquarian book is a facsimile reprint of the old original and may contain some imperfections such as library marks and notations.
